A document or application is typically represented by an icon that resembles a piece of paper or a file folder, often accompanied by a specific symbol or logo related to the application. For example, a word processing application might use a document icon with text lines, while a spreadsheet application might feature a grid-style icon. These icons help users quickly identify the type of document or application at a glance.

Difference between document-centric approach versus application-centric approach?

The difference between application-centric approach and document-centric approach is that with application-centric approach you open an application (such as notepad) and then create a document. With document-centric approach you create a document without opening an application first. You can create a document from the desktop by right clicking on the desktop, then click on New. On the submenu click on text document (or whichever command you choose).
